Avon Schools Will Soon Get Solar Power
The high school and middle school will soon have solar panels installed.

The installation of solar panels at the Avon high and middle schools is set to start by the end of March.
The project’s design has been in the works for months by contractor Solar City, according to the Hartford Courant.

The town would buy electricity generated by the panels over the course of 15 years, which should save the town about $350,000.
Installation was delayed to ensure the middle school’s roof could support the weight of the panels and snow.
